**Capacity note — Emberline loyalty ledger.** The ledger is append-only; balances are derived from periodic snapshots plus a tail of recent entries. At current growth (~9M entries/month) the tail replay cost dominates read latency, so snapshot cadence matters. Security-relevant detail: compaction permanently merges entries, which limits forensic granularity — the retention constant below is therefore an audit decision, not just a cost one. The cadence, tail length, and retention constants we plan to run with are as follows.

constants for tageg-kagag:
QUOTAS = {
    "kelax": 495,
    "istath": 366,
    "tammir": 108,
    "novdor": 730,
    "casax": 816,
    "quenael": 874,
    "pelius": 403,
}

Hey Priya — handing over the Quotaloom release before I'm out. The per-tenant rate quota change is mostly done; the new ledger applies burst credits per tenant instead of globally, and the migration backfills existing tenants at their current ceiling. Please review the quota-reconciliation job closely, that's the riskiest bit. Everything else is rubber-stamp territory. When you cut the release, the pipeline will prompt you to sign the manifest before it'll push to Harrowgate prod. Here's the deploy key you'll need.

rollout seal: bky4_x7Gc

Ticket: Staging env misconfigured for Siftgate bloom filter

The bloom layer in front of the Pellet KV store is rejecting all lookups in staging because the env file was copied from the dev template without credentials. False-positive tuning values are fine; only the auth line is missing. To unblock the weekly demo, the Pellet admission secret must be set on the following line.

env line for yaguf-fajop: LEDGER_TOKEN13=fb08984397349

Fan-out backpressure for the Quillet notifier: when the queue depth crosses the soft limit, the dispatcher sheds low-priority pushes and batches the rest at 500ms intervals. Reviewer should confirm the shed counter is exported and that retries respect the jitter window. Once merged, the release artifact gets re-signed by the pipeline, which expects the deploy key shown below.

deploy key for bawep-yawif: bky6_GQhaSt